It's one of the reasons why I love the Lightning ST mod for my Atari Mega ST4. I've got USB support. I literally stick a card reader with an SD card in it, into the USB port on the Mega ST4, drag 'n drop my entire C: partition over to that drive and bam! instant backup. I then take it to my Mega STe, drop it off there via the internal Ultrasatan drive (SD cards, 2 slots), then to my Kubuntu Linux laptop, then finally, last (and least), the Win10 box. I do that regularly once a month, or more often if I do any major changes/updates. That should keep me pretty protected as far as data loss goes.
